The Premium Tax Credit is for those with income between 100 % and 400 % of the Federal Poverty Level who buy
health insurance via
government - run
marketplace.

All
health insurance plans on
government - run
marketplaces offer a set of preventative healthcare services, such as shots and screening tests, at no cost to plan members (even if you haven't hit your deductible).
To use these
government subsidies, you must purchase an «on - exchange» or
marketplace health insurance plan.
Many states also have
health insurance marketplaces which they run separately from the federal
government Marketplace.
In order to qualify for a
government premium subsidy, you must purchase a
health insurance policy that has been approved for a
government marketplace such as Healthcare.gov.
Healthcare.gov is the
health insurance marketplace operated by the federal
government.
